SECTION 1

Anxiety is a feeling of unease, such as worry or fear, and the symptoms range from mild to severe and is also an umbrella term that covers a number of diagnosable conditions. This section will provide an introduction to anxiety and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(CBT). 

SECTION 2

Anxiety looks and feels different for different people, which means the solutions for reducing anxiety will also differ for each person. So in this section, we offer a variety of ideas and tools - some are based on mindfulness, and others are based on CBT techniques.

According to statistics published by the HSE, in 2021/22, there were an estimated 914,000 cases of work-related stress, depression or anxiety. 

Therefore, the need for awareness and education on the subject of mental health is apparent. This Managing Anxiety Training course provides ideas and techniques to help people to manage their anxiety, this includes belly breathing techniques, strengthening your resilience and ABC forms that help people to highlight how they felt and behaved during an anxiety-provoking event.

CBT, or cognitive behavioural therapy, can play a key part in helping people better manage anxious thoughts. Recognised by the NHS, here is how they describe the process:

"C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T) is a talking therapy that can help you manage your problems by changing the way you think and behave. It's most commonly used to treat anxiety and depression, but can be useful for other mental and physical health problems." - NHS

Why is this training important?

Business benefits

Managing the mental health of your employees is essential to create a happy working environment for all. However, there are occasions where stress or anxiety will be a factor as a result of a working-related issue. It may stem from a lack of support, workplace or business changes, or even instances of bullying. It is absolutely crucial that your employees are aware of how to best deal with anxious thoughts whilst at work. 

Our anxiety management training course aims to provide the user with the right techniques and tools to manage anxious thoughts safely and effectively.
